Introducing the SMA-KFD288G RF Coaxial Connector, the epitome of performance and reliability in high-frequency transmissions. Engineered with precision, this connector boasts a robust 50Ω impedance, ensuring pristine signal integrity across a wide frequency range (0-12.4GHz for flexible cable and 0-18GHz for semi-rigid).
Built to withstand the rigors of demanding environments, the SMA-KFD288G RF Coaxial Connector features exceptional durability with 500 mating cycles and a wide operating temperature range from -65°C to +165°C. Its high insulation resistance (5000 MΩ) and dielectric withstanding voltage (1000 V) provide superior protection against electrical hazards.
Whether you're working with flexible or semi-rigid cables, the SMA-KFD288G RF Coaxial Connector delivers unparalleled VSWR performance (1.15+0.02F for flexible cable and 1.10+0.02F for semi-rigid). Frequency Range: The SMA-KFD288G operates seamlessly across a wide frequency spectrum, spanning from DC (direct current) up to an impressive 18 GHz. Whether you’re dealing with low-frequency signals or high-speed data, this connector has you covered.
Operating Temperature Range: Designed to withstand extreme conditions, the SMA-KFD288G can brave temperatures as low as -55°C and as high as +165°C. From frigid mountaintops to scorching industrial environments, it maintains its performance and reliability.
Pin Diameter: The connector’s pin diameter measures a precise 0.30 mm, ensuring optimal signal transmission and minimal losses. Precision matters, especially in critical applications.
Voltage Rating (Dielectric Withstanding Voltage): With a robust dielectric design, the SMA-KFD288G can handle up to 500 Vrms (root mean square voltage). This insulation capability prevents electrical breakdown and ensures safe operation.
VSWR (Voltage Standing Wave Ratio): The VSWR of 1.15:1 indicates excellent impedance matching. Lower VSWR values mean less signal reflection and better overall performance.
Insulator Material: The SMA-KFD288G uses either PTFE (polytetrafluoroethylene) or LCP (liquid crystal polymer) as the insulator material. Both options offer low loss and high-temperature stability, making them ideal for RF applications.
Seal Ring: The connector features a silicon rubber seal ring, ensuring reliable sealing and preventing moisture ingress.
Contact Resistance: The center contact has a maximum resistance of 3 mΩ, while the outer contact maintains a resistance of ≤ 2 mΩ. Low contact resistance ensures efficient signal transfer.
Durability: The SMA-KFD288G withstands 500 mating cycles, making it durable for repeated connections and disconnections.
Insulation Resistance: The insulation resistance exceeds 5000 MΩ, ensuring minimal leakage and reliable isolation between conductors.
Body Material and Finish: The connector’s body and other metal parts are made of stainless steel with a passivated finish. This combination ensures longevity and corrosion resistance.
